Brands are trading in their traditional campaign tentpoles for a new creative playbook: world-building. 

That pivot played out on the international stage last month during the 2026 FIFA World Cup, where companies like McDonald’s and Nike built immersive, expansive brand worlds instead of hinging their efforts around a single blockbuster ad. 

For its biggest-ever World Cup campaign and largest marketing effort of the year, spanning more than 110 countries, McDonald’s moved “from polished ads to creating an ecosystem [that spans] creators, fans, and experiences,” global chief marketing officer Morgan Flatley told ADWEEK.
